EVERYBODY WANTS SOME || Richard Linklater follows up “Dazed And Confused” with yet another blast from the past, following a college baseball team during the last days of summer leading up to the first day of class. The writing and the fraternity dynamic from the mostly unknown cast work wonders here. And Zoey Deutch continues to prove she’s the newest girl next door to hit Hollywood. |

GOD’S NOT DEAD 2 || Faith-based films are getting so heavy handed, it’s absolutely ridiculous. Melissa Joan Hart resurfaces to take on the role of the prosecuted teacher who uses God in one her lessons and is eventually put on trial, basically being forced to denounce her belief in God for some reason. It’s all completely melodramatic and unbelievable, which makes SNL’s parody of it even better: www.nbc.com/saturday-night-live/video/god-is-a-boob-man/3021131 |
